The Massachusetts Museum of Contemporary Art (MASS MoCA) is a large contemporary art museum in North Adams, Massachusetts, housed in a complex of converted 19th-century mill buildings. The institution opened as an arts center in the late 1990s and is known for large-scale installations and multidisciplinary programming.
Galleries span multiple connected buildings and are notable for accommodating oversized works, site-specific installations and rotating exhibitions; the campus also presents music, theater and film events. Visitors use the museum to see major contemporary projects that would not fit in traditional gallery spaces.
The museum was developed through adaptive reuse of former industrial buildings and has expanded to include performance spaces and artist studios. It operates as a major cultural anchor in the northern Berkshires and attracts regional and national audiences.
MASS MoCA sits in North Adams in Berkshire County, western Massachusetts, near the Vermont border and accessible by road from surrounding towns and by regional transit.

How to Get to Massachusetts Museum of Contemporary Art #
Mass MoCA is a short walk from downtown North Adams. By car, follow MA-8 into North Adams and look for signs to Mass MoCA Way; there is a large parking lot. The nearest major highway is Massachusetts Route 2. Limited public transit serves North Adams; check Berkshire Regional Transit Authority schedules for local connections.
Tips for Visiting Massachusetts Museum of Contemporary Art #
- Check the museum's website for major installation closures - some large-scale works require separate timed entries or have limited viewing windows.
- Allow at least three hours: Mass MoCA is a sprawling complex where a single room-sized installation can take up the better part of an hour.
- Park in the large lot off Mass MoCA Way and enter through Building 5 for the easiest access to the main galleries and visitor services.

Weather & Climate near Massachusetts Museum of Contemporary Art #
Massachusetts Museum of Contemporary Art's climate is classified as Warm-Summer Continental - Warm-Summer Continental climate with warm summers (peaking in July) and freezing winters (coldest in January). Temperatures range from -12°C to 27°C. Abundant rainfall (1124 mm/year), wettest in May, distributed fairly evenly throughout the year.
